Apart from Josephine, all founding members are ardent Chantry loyalists. The values and beliefs are all the same either way.
I think that's a bit much. Sure, they're Andrastians, but they are different kind of Andrastians. Leliana is fairly unconventional as shown in Origins; Cassandra seems quite willing to welcome new interpretations of divine will and give the middle-finger to Chantry bureaucracy; Cullen also turned against Meredith when push came to shove. Those beliefs are NOT the same.
If you're hell-bent on toppling the Chantry, then yeah, you'll probably be disappointed that the dominant religion of all of Thedas remains a significantly powerful influence on the world / game. But come on, who expected different? The fact that a Quanri or Dalish who can openly say they don't go inf or the Chantry stuff is still being followed by the entire organization still indicates a large dose of secularity to me.
